Carrd vs React.js
psychology AI Verdict
React.js excels in its ability to handle complex user interfaces with ease, thanks to its robust component-based architecture and efficient rendering capabilities. It is particularly adept at managing state changes and updating only the necessary parts of an application, which significantly enhances performance and reduces load times. React's extensive documentation and large community support make it a versatile choice for developers looking to build dynamic web applications.
In contrast, Carrd shines in its simplicity and speed, offering a minimalist approach that is perfect for creating clean, responsive single-page websites and landing pages. Its affordable pricing and wide range of elegant templates make it an attractive option for small businesses and individuals who need a straightforward solution without the complexity of full-fledged development tools. While both platforms have their strengths, React.js clearly outshines Carrd in terms of performance and flexibility, making it the better choice for developers looking to build complex web applications or manage large-scale projects.
thumbs_up_down Pros & Cons
check_circle Pros
- User-friendly drag-and-drop interface
- Affordable pricing with a free tier
- Wide range of elegant templates
cancel Cons
- Limited features compared to React.js
- Not suitable for complex applications
check_circle Pros
- Supports server-side rendering (SSR) and static site generation (SSG)
- Efficient component-based architecture
- Large community support and extensive documentation
cancel Cons
- Steep learning curve for beginners
- Requires additional setup and configuration
compare Feature Comparison
| Feature | Carrd | React.js |
|---|---|---|
| Component-Based Architecture | No, built on a simpler template-based system | Yes, allowing efficient state management and reusability |
| Server-Side Rendering (SSR) | No, focuses on simplicity over advanced features | Yes, enhancing performance and SEO |
| Static Site Generation (SSG) | No, not a focus of the platform | Yes, for creating static websites |
| Drag-and-Drop Interface | Yes, making it accessible to non-coders | No, requires coding knowledge |
| Community Support and Documentation | Limited community support compared to React.js | Large community and extensive documentation available |
| Pricing Model | Free tier with affordable pro plans starting at $9 per month | Free for open-source use, paid plans available |
payments Pricing
Carrd
React.js
difference Key Differences
help When to Choose
- If you prioritize simplicity and speed for creating single-page websites and landing pages.
- If you are a small business or individual with limited coding experience.
- If you need an affordable solution without the complexity of full-fledged development tools.
- If you prioritize complex web application development or large-scale projects.
- If you need advanced features like server-side rendering and static site generation.
- If you choose React.js if your team has experienced developers who can leverage its powerful capabilities.